¿Cuánto cuesta alquilar una casa en Sharpstown?
| Dormitorios | Precio Promedio | Más barato | Más caro |
|---|---|---|---|
| Casas en Alquiler 2 Dormitorios en Sharpstown | $1,450 | $950 | $2,500 |
| Casas en Alquiler 3 Dormitorios en Sharpstown | $2,032 | $1,500 | $2,800 |
| Casas en Alquiler 4 Dormitorios en Sharpstown | $2,356 | $1,700 | $3,500 |
| Casas en Alquiler 5 Dormitorios en Sharpstown | $2,400 | $2,400 | $2,400 |

Preguntas frecuentes sobre alquileres en Sharpstown
¿Que tipo de alquileres hay actualmente en Sharpstown?
Actualmente hay 150 Apartamentos de Alquiler en Sharpstown, TX con precios que van desde $450 hasta $1,950. También hay 103 Casas Unifamiliares, Condominios y Casas Adosadas en alquiler disponibles actualmente en Sharpstown que van desde $875 hasta $3,500.
¿Cuál es el rango de precios actual de las viviendas de alquiler en Sharpstown?
Los precios hoy en día para las casas, condominios y casas adosadas en alquiler en Sharpstown oscilan entre $875 hasta $3,500 con un alquiler mensual promedio de $1,870.
